2014 Subaru Legacy 2.5i, Automatic CVT Trans
Check Turn Signal And Hazard Module
2014 Subaru Legacy 2.5i, Automatic CVT TransSECTION Check Turn Signal And Hazard Module
- Measure the voltage between turn signal & hazard module connector and chassis ground.
Preparation tool:Β
Circuit testerΒ
ConnectorΒ
Terminal No. Input/Output Inspection conditions Standard 6 β Chassis ground Input Turn signal switch (Right) OFF β ON 9 V or more β less than 1 V 5 β Chassis ground Input Turn signal switch (Left) OFF β ON 9 V or more β less than 1 V 8 β Chassis ground Input Hazard switch OFF β ON 9 V or more β less than 1 V 2 β Chassis ground Output Turn signal switch (Right) OFF β ON Repeat less than 1 V β less than 1 V β more than 9 V at 60 to 120 times per minute. 3 β Chassis ground Output Turn signal switch (Left) OFF β ON Repeat less than 1 V β less than 1 V β more than 9 V at 60 to 120 times per minute. 2 β Chassis ground Output Hazard switch OFF β ON Repeat less than 1 V β less than 1 V β more than 9 V at 60 to 120 times per minute. 3 β Chassis ground Output Hazard switch OFF β ON Repeat less than 1 V β less than 1 V β more than 9 V at 60 to 120 times per minute. - Replace the turn signal and hazard module if the inspection result is not within the standard value.

When to See a Mechanic
Stop DIY work and contact a certified mechanic immediately if any of the following apply:
- β’ You smell fuel, burning insulation, or see smoke.
- β’ Brakes feel soft, pull hard to one side, or make grinding noises.
- β’ The engine overheats, stalls repeatedly, or misfires under load.
- β’ You are missing required tools, torque specs, or safe lifting equipment.
- β’ You are not confident in the next step or safety outcome.
